Google Adsense

One of the most popular ways to make money on Google is through Google Adsense. This program allows you to display ads on your website or blog and earn money based on the number of clicks and impressions. To get started, you need to create a Google Adsense account, sign up for the program, and then place the provided ad code on your website. It’s important to ensure that your content is high-quality and relevant to your audience to maximize earnings.

YouTube Monetization

YouTube is another excellent platform for making money on Google. If you have a passion for creating content, you can start a YouTube channel and monetize it through ads, sponsorships, and merchandise. To monetize your channel, you need to have at least 1,000 subscribers and 4,000 hours of watch time in the past 12 months. Once you meet these criteria, you can apply for the YouTube Partner Program and start earning money.
